Triple Offset Butterfly Valves (TOV)

Compared to traditional valves, butterfly valves are smaller and lighter, making them ideal for space-conscious plant designs. However, conventional, high-performance or interference fit butterfly valves do not have the control or shut off requirements for high pressure, high-temperature applications. The Triple Offset design moves the center of rotation within the valve. It utilizes an ellipsoidal sealing geometry, allowing a wide range of metal seating materials to be used, providing zero-leakage performance on high temperatures, high pressure, and fire-safe applications.

Compared to the double eccentric butterfly valve design, which is position seated and requires high friction to seal (this will accelerate seal wear due to friction), triple offset butterfly valves are torque seated. Excess rotation of the valve causes more significant interference between the disc and the seat due to the eccentric geometry. With the proper torque, they will meet bi-directional zero leakage shutoff per API 598.
